The full moon cast its diffused light over the rooftops of Old Alcudia as Liz and I strolled around the top of the ancient city walls.
Below us we could hear the chatter of late night shoppers and diners enjoying the warm evening air, but up here we were in a world of our own.
Just as well really, because when I came to take this photo of the rooftops I found my tripod taking up the entire width of the walkway.
With a thirty second exposure I had to keep a careful lookout for approaching pedestrians, and time my triggering of the shutter to allow enough time for the camera to take the image without becoming a nuisance.
This was the best of the three frames I took of this scene, with the exposure pushed as high as I could without losing too much detail in the brightly lit clouds.
All in all, a magical night time experience, with the promise of a lovely dinner to follow - what's not to like?
Filename - mallorca alcudia 04.jpg
Camera - Canon 5D
Lens - 24-105mm zoom @ 30mm
Exposure - 30 secs @ f10, ISO100
Location - Old Alcudia, Mallorca, Spain
This image - 800x533px JPEG
Conversion - Lightroom and PhotoShop CC
Comments - Tripod, cable release and mirror lockup used to reduce camera vibration.
